Chiretta

Swertia chirata

Chiretta is an annual plant that grows up to 1 meter tall. It has lance-shaped leaves, smooth pointed stems, and pale green blooms with a purple tint.

Before the widespread availability of quinine, chiretta was a popular malaria remedy.

Chiretta plants grow in high elevations in northern India and Nepal. The entire herb is harvested during its flowering season.
